Revelation 2-3 are the 7 letters to the 7 churches. The Lord says first and foremost of each of the 7 churches in each letter: “I know your works.” It is very important what you do, not just what you say.
Rev 2:6 But this thou hast, that thou hatest the works of the Nicolaitans, which I also hate. They say you have to go thru them to get to God, a teaching which Jesus hates, because this doctrine is not true.
Proverbs 6:16-19 ASV: “There are six things which Jehovah hateth; Yea, seven which are an abomination unto him: 17 Haughty eyes, a lying tongue, And hands that shed innocent blood; 18 A heart that deviseth wicked purposes, Feet that are swift in running to mischief, 19 A false witness that uttereth lies, And he that soweth discord among brethren.”
